Janusz Fortecki was a distinguished Polish ski jumper who represented his nation during a remarkable career spanning the mid-20th century. His athletic achievements in the sport of ski jumping earned him recognition as one of Poland's notable winter sports competitors during an era when the discipline was gaining international prominence.
Fortecki's legacy in Polish skiing remains part of the country's rich sporting heritage. He passed away in 2020 and was laid to rest in the New Cemetery in Zakopane, a fitting final resting place in the heart of Poland's winter sports region.
